When an animal cell is placed in a hypotonic environment, it will:
Correct answer: A. Undergo cytolysis
- A. Undergo cytolysis
- B. Undergo plasmolysis
- C. Be at equilibrium
- D. Its turgor pressure decreases
Explanation
When an animal cell is placed in a hypotonic environment, it will undergo cytolysis. Here's why:Hypotonic Environment: A hypotonic environment has a lower solute concentration (and therefore a higher water concentration) than the inside of the cell.Osmosis: Water moves across the cell membrane from an area of high water concentration (outside the cell) to an area of low water concentration (inside the cell) through osmosis.Cytolysis: As water enters the animal cell, it swells. Unlike plant cells, animal cells lack a rigid cell wall. The cell membrane can only stretch so much. If too much water enters, the cell membrane will burst, a process called cytolysis (or osmotic lysis).Here's why the other options are incorrect:Be at equilibrium: Equilibrium occurs in an isotonic environment, where the solute concentration is the same inside and outside the cell.Undergo plasmolysis: Plasmolysis occurs in a hypertonic environment, where the solute concentration is higher outside the cell. Water moves out of the cell, causing the cell membrane to shrink away from the cell wall (in plant cells). Since animal cells don't have a cell wall, they simply shrink.Therefore, the correct answer is undergo cytolysis.
